NEWS: Hubs in Pubs
5 Hubs are emerging across Cumbria,
roughly: north, east, south/central, south and west. The groups so far are made up of a diversity of practitioners including 2
and 3D, web, film and music interests, and look set to form a really dynamic base for the projects.

ARTIST SOUGHT FOR ANTI-ROAD CAMPAIGN Transport Solutions for Lancaster and Morecambe are appealing for an artist who can create a visual impression of the key features of the Heysham M6 Link Road. The plans include a dual carriageway with several road bridges, a flyover 43' high and numerous steep embankments, and along one stretch there will be 8 lanes of traffic. All of them ploughing through greenfield sites in North Lancaster and Torrisholme, to the dismay of local residents and veteran road protestors who, backed by the evidence of the County Council's own research, point out the road will not solve the vast majority of Lancaster's traffic problems. The County Council of course, is in favour of the road... See the maps and diagrams at http://www.heyshamm6link.info |

WWW | Wray Scarecrow Festival. All through the winter the quaintly snowed-in rural folk of Wray Village have been eccentrically passing the time engaged in their indigenous craft - making fabulous scarecrows! The streets, lanes and alleyways of this picturesque village will be populated by tableaux and fantasy creations on all kinds of themes - politics, TV and more. I think we can expect some royal scarecrows for sure. There will be delicious and cheap home-made refreshments in Wray Institute all week. There will be a display of costumes and flowers 'Moments in Time' with music at Holy Trinity Church. David and Goliath Rap Mon-Fri Wray school 11am + 2pm. The Festival kicks off today with the St George's Day celebrations, and finishes with the big fair on May Monday. Don't miss this. You just have to go.
